Virgin wool is the softest type of wool, sourced from the first shearing of lambs. Virgin wool fabric is derived from the hair fibers of sheep that have never been shorn or recycled. It is taken from a sheep’s first shearing, this being the softest coat a sheep will produce in its life. Find out how to care for. It is highly prized in the fashion and textile industry for its superior quality,. Sometimes, virgin wool also refers to types of wool fibres that have not undergone any processing procedures.
